Here Come the Crossovers
As sales of SUVs and minivans struggle, leaner, more fuel efficient crossovers are the auto industry’s next big thing

Sometimes the latest and greatest isn't new at all. For the 2007-08 model year, auto manufacturers are banking big on so-called crossovers, vehicles built on car platforms that adopt SUV-like practicality and cargo room while maintaining reasonable fuel economy and often even zippy handling.
Though currently heralded as the antidote to the slump in SUV sales that has devastated the domestic auto manufacturers' bottoms lines, crossovers have been around for years. That hasn't stopped some carmakers—Ford (F) and General Motors (GM) in particular—from pushing the newest crop hard.
